The Nasarawa State Police Command has initiated a manhunt following a communal attack in Udege that left at least 11 people dead and several homes destroyed. The attack, which occurred in the early hours of April 3, was reportedly carried out by suspected hoodlums in retaliation for the alleged killing of two individuals. Police Commissioner CP Shetima Jauro Mohammed visited the affected communities and assured that those responsible would be brought to justice.
